From af811f3dbc950149191c81ea21bd10adbc3743dc Mon Sep 17 00:00:00 2001 From: Julian Ospald Date: Tue, 28 Jul 2020 21:40:26 +0200 Subject: [PATCH] `nub` result in getInstalledCabals --- lib/GHCup/Utils.hs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/GHCup/Utils.hs b/lib/GHCup/Utils.hs index 0f04867..052a057 100644 --- a/lib/GHCup/Utils.hs +++ b/lib/GHCup/Utils.hs @@ -245,7 +245,7 @@ getInstalledCabals = do Just (Left _) -> pure $ Left f Nothing -> pure $ Left f cs <- cabalSet -- for legacy cabal - pure $ maybe vs (\x -> Right x:vs) cs + pure $ maybe vs (\x -> nub $ Right x:vs) cs -- | Whether the given cabal version is installed.